Dave Gibbons Historic Watchmen #1 "Bloody Smiley Face/Doomsday Clock" Cover Original Art (DC, 1986). "At midnight, all the agents and superhuman crew go out and round up everyone who knows more than they do." -- Desolation Row by Bob Dylan. Here is the historic, iconic cover image that kicked off a revolution in comics history: Gibbons' opening shot of the Comedian's bloody badge, which doubled as a "smiley face/doomsday clock," for writer Alan Moore's classic take on the superhero genre in "At midnight, All the agents." Widely considered to be one of the greatest stories in modern comics history, this issue featured the first appearances of the now-legendary Rorschach, Ozymandias, Dr. Manhattan, Silk Spectre, and Nite Owl, as well as the shocking death of the antihero the Comedian. This DC masterwork has an image area of 10" x 15", and the art is in Excellent condition. From the Shamus Modern Masterworks Collection.
